Transaction 31ed3eb9143461562822ccff23ca4b33512cd686739a54713196b5e9f1048771
1 Input
1 Output
-
31ed3eb9143461562822ccff23ca4b33512cd686739a54713196b5e9f1048771:0
- value
- 10474548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de9589c2e811585e45dba112512e07fcf7d88d3a OP_EQUAL
- address
- 3Myw5DoYhNaSWDfx2P1FnSgKedCgnkZoSg